T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to the field of wind power generation, in particular to a wind power generation state monitoring and early warning method and system. BACKGROUND
[0002] With the accelerated promotion of global energy transformation, wind power, as the main force of clean energy, its installed capacity and single machine scale continue to grow, and wind farms are increasingly expanding to complex environmental areas such as the sea, highlands, and remote areas. However, the large-scale wind turbines and complex sites have significantly increased the difficulty and cost of their operation and maintenance while improving power generation efficiency. Wind turbines, as complex mechanical and electrical systems exposed to harsh working conditions for a long time, their blades, gearboxes, generators, and main shafts are subjected to the continuous impact of alternating loads, fatigue stress, and natural erosion, resulting in high failure rates.
[0003] However, the traditional "periodic maintenance" and "after-maintenance" mode has been difficult to meet the needs of the development of modern wind power industry. Periodic maintenance has the risk of over-maintenance or insufficient maintenance, causing resource waste or failure to detect faults; and after-maintenance means unplanned downtime, heavy loss of power generation, and even may cause serious secondary damage, resulting in high repair costs. [0026] Specifically, historical data of wind turbines in a healthy state are collected and grouped by parameter type to form multiple normal power generation parameter data groups. For each data group, the K-Means clustering algorithm is independently applied to automatically divide the normal operating conditions in the multi-dimensional parameter space into several clusters, each representing a specific healthy operating mode, and the geometric center of each cluster is calculated. By calculating the maximum Euclidean distance from all data points within each cluster to its cluster center, a dynamic, data-driven anomaly detection boundary is defined for each operating mode, achieving accurate anomaly identification through multi-condition adaptive analysis. This approach can simultaneously consider the coordinated changes of multiple parameters, establishing different normal ranges for different operating modes and significantly reducing the false alarm rate. When new power generation forecast data is input, it is mapped to the corresponding parameter group cluster, and the calculation... The system calculates the distance to the center of its cluster. If the distance exceeds the cluster's individual anomaly threshold, it is marked as abnormal data, enabling early detection of systemic deviations. By statistically analyzing the number of abnormal data points in the predicted data set for each parameter and comparing it with a preset threshold, the system can not only detect instantaneous anomalies of individual data points but also capture the overall trend of parameters deviating from the normal pattern. This judgment based on "anomaly density" makes the system more sensitive to potential performance degradation or progressive failures, and can issue early warnings at an earlier stage of failure development. It elevates anomaly detection from a simple "single parameter-single threshold" judgment to an intelligent diagnostic level of "multi-parameter-multi-mode-dynamic threshold," providing a more accurate and reliable decision-making basis for predictive maintenance of wind turbines, effectively improving operation and maintenance efficiency and wind turbine reliability.

[0028] Specifically, features are constructed from two key dimensions. First, the proportion of anomalous data is calculated. This indicator reflects the frequency and prevalence of anomalies. A high proportion means that the parameter has experienced a systematic and widespread deviation throughout the prediction period, rather than isolated instantaneous fluctuations. Second, the range of anomalous data intervals is calculated, which is the difference between the maximum and minimum values in the anomalous data set. This indicator reveals the severity and range boundaries of anomalous fluctuations. A large range indicates that the parameter not only deviates from normal but also exhibits significant fluctuations or remains at an extremely high level under anomalous conditions. This step enables in-depth insight and quantitative assessment of anomalous states, transforming the vague concept of "anomaly" into precise "breadth" and "intensity" indicators, providing operations and maintenance personnel with richer and more accurate information about failure modes. Multi-feature analysis lays a solid foundation for subsequent failure severity classification and root cause analysis. By integrating these two features, the priority of different anomalies can be intelligently assessed, thereby guiding the operations and maintenance team to formulate more targeted maintenance strategies and effectively improving the allocation efficiency of operations and maintenance resources and the accuracy of fault handling.

[0030] Specifically, two key features of each anomaly parameter—the anomaly percentage (first feature) and the anomaly range (second feature)—are independently evaluated and converted into specific numerical values (first and second anomaly evaluation values). By introducing a benchmark "standard anomaly evaluation value," the severity of the deviation of the current anomaly state from the benchmark is accurately quantified by calculating the "difference" between each feature evaluation value and its corresponding standard value. The difference is mapped to a score through a preset scoring model and normalized to unify features (percentage and range) with different dimensions and physical meanings onto a comparable scale. Appropriate weights are dynamically allocated based on the contribution of the difference to the overall anomaly. By weighting the evaluation values of each feature with their calculated weights, a single, quantitative anomaly severity evaluation value for each anomaly parameter is obtained, enabling precise prioritization of anomalies. This allows for clear identification of which of multiple simultaneously occurring anomaly parameters needs to be prioritized due to its wider anomaly range and more drastic fluctuations. Thus, multidimensional and complex anomaly information is extracted into intelligent signals that directly support decision-making, greatly improving the accuracy of early warning and the efficiency of operational actions.

[0034] In the embodiments of this application, a method for monitoring and early warning of wind power generation status is provided. The method for determining the early warning strategy of the wind turbine based on the status coefficient includes: if the status coefficient of the wind turbine is less than a first preset value, the early warning strategy is to mark the wind turbine on the monitoring interface, list the specific abnormal parameters and abnormality assessment values, and include the wind turbine in the key inspection objects of the next regular inspection, reminding the inspection personnel to pay attention to specific components; if the status coefficient of the wind turbine is greater than the first preset value and less than the second preset value, the early warning strategy is to send a formal warning to the operation and maintenance team, automatically generate a preliminary maintenance work order, and start a deep diagnostic model to further locate the root cause of the fault; if the status coefficient of the wind turbine is greater than the second preset value and less than the third preset value, the early warning strategy is to dispatch the operation and maintenance team to conduct on-site inspection within a specified time, automatically adjust the wind turbine operation strategy, and formulate a specific maintenance plan and schedule; if the status coefficient of the wind turbine is greater than the third preset value, the early warning strategy is to automatically execute a protective shutdown, initiate an emergency maintenance process, and immediately dispatch a team to the site for handling.
